How To Make A Small Backyard Look Bigger. Incorporating terraced landscaping helps to designate spaces, making a small yard look bigger. Use climbing plants to lead the eye upwards. With a few landscaping tricks, you can trick the eye to and senses to make the yard look and feel bigger than it really is, and the good thing is these tricks aren’t too difficult to do, either. Mix things up by including different levels and steps. Whether you're looking for ways to enhance your small backyard and make it feel bigger, or you've just moved into a new home and want to completely rework an outdoor space, there are plenty of ways to visually extend the feeling of space. Choose light colors to create an expansive effect. Borrow an adjacent landscape to 'extend' a boundary. 8 simple tips to make a backyard look bigger. Soften and disguise the perimeter with tall planting. Elevate your dining area, or sink a. Here are 20 small backyard ideas to make it look bigger. Divide up the space then slowly reveal different parts.
